    I recently ran "yum update @sound-and-video" and a few oddities have crept up:

    • Fn+Up / Down no longer controls volume - the usual graphic pops up onscreen, but showing 0 volume and nothing happens[/*:m:3o2ibjse]
    • Amarok gives me this error: "xine was unable to initialize any audio drivers"[/*:m:3o2ibjse]
    • Skype gives me "problem with audio playback"[/*:m:3o2ibjse]

    Not really sure what's happened but sound still works (at 100% volume) in other apps like VLC or Flash in Firefox, any help here would be massively appreciated - the keyboard / amarok thing is annoying, but Skype not working is a real problem :(
